Wild water buffalo
Species name: Bubalis bubalis
The wild water buffalo (Bubalis bubalis arnee or 'Bubalus arnee) is a large ungulate, a member of the bovine subfamily and the ancestor of the domestic water buffalo. It is the second largest wild bovid, smaller only than the Gaur. It is an endangered species, thought to survive in (from west to east) India, Nepal, Bhutan, Myanmar and Thailand. Wild Asian water buffalo are extinct in Pakistan, Bangladesh, Laos and Viet Nam. (Source:Wikipedia) Although domesticated water buffalo are thriving and are distributed well beyond their native range, true wild water buffalo are in jeopardy. It may be that no true wild water buffalo exist, but have been lost to interbreeding with domesticated or feral buffalo. (Source:Encyclopedia of Life through Animal Diversity Web)

ChordataThe phylum Chordata consists of three subphyla: Urochordata, represented by tunicates; Cephalochordata, represented by lancelets; and Craniata, which includes Vertebrata. Chordates are monophyletic, meaning that Chordata contains all and only the descendants of a single common ancestor which is itself a chordate, and that craniates' nearest relatives are cephalochordates. The Chordates arose from a more general superphylum Deuterostomia, which consists of Chordata, Hemichordata,Echinodermata and Xenoturbellida. The Deuterostomes split from Protostomes ~550 mya in the Cambrian era. It is supposed that Chordates arose in the Mid-Cambrian period, however there is controversy regarding that. The controversy arises mainly due to the fact that fossils of early chordates are very rare.Chordates form a phylum of creatures that are based on a bilateral body plan, and is defined by having at some stage in their lives all of the following: 1) A notochord, 2) A dorsal neural tube 3) Pharyngeal slits 4) A muscular tail that extends backwards behind the anus and 5) An endostyle

MammaliaDepending on classification scheme, there are approximately 5,500 species (5,490, according to the IUCN Red List) of mammals, distributed in about 1,200 genera, 153 families, 29 orders The early synapsid mammalian ancestors, a group which included pelycosaurs such as Dimetrodon, diverged from the amniote line that would lead to reptiles at the end of the Carboniferous period. Although they were preceded by many diverse groups of non-mammalian synapsids (sometimes misleadingly referred to as mammal-like reptiles), the first true mammals appeared 220 million years ago in the Triassic period.Mammals are a class of air-breathing vertebrate animals characterized by the (1) possession of hair, (2) three middle ear bones -malleus, incus and stapes, (3) a neocortex, and (4) mammary glands functional in mothers with young. Mammalian fossils, however, are identified by the presence of the incus and malleus bones in the middle ear. Most mammals also possess sweat glands and specialized teeth, and the largest group of mammals, the placentals, have a placenta which feeds the offspring during gestation. The mammalian brain regulates endothermic and circulatory systems, including a four-chambered heart. Mammals range in size from the 30–40 millimeter (1- to 1.5-inch) Bumblebee Bat to the 33-meter (108-foot) Blue Whale. (Source:Wikipedia)

BovidaeAlmost 140 species of cloven-hoofed mammals belonging to the family Bovidae are called bovids. The family is widespread, being native to Asia, Africa, Europe and North America, and diverse: members include bison, African buffalo, water buffalo, antelopes, gazelles, sheep, goats, muskoxen, and domestic cattle. The largest number of modern bovids is found in Africa The bovid family is known through fossils from the early Miocene, around 20 million years ago. The earliest bovids, such as Eotragus, were small animals, somewhat similar to modern gazelles, and probably lived in woodland environments. The bovids rapidly diversified, and by the late Miocene had moved onto grassland habitats.The largest bovid, the gaur, weighs well over a ton and stands 2.2 metres high at the shoulder; the smallest, the royal antelope, weighs about 3 kg and stands no taller than a large domestic cat. They occupy, and are adapted to, a wide variety of habitat types, from desert to tundra and from thick tropical forest to high mountains. Most members of the family are herbivorous. Many bovids have a solid, stocky build, complex digestive systems (four chambered stomach) and four toes on each foot. Additionally, males of most species have horns, which have been linked to sexual selection.
